Teacher of Girls' PE job summary

Fixed term contract for one year in the first instance (with the potential for a permanent position)

We are looking for a dynamic and talented Teacher of Girls PE with a specialism in Netball to join our thriving and highly successful department. The successful candidate should have broad based subject knowledge in order to teach PE at Key Stages 3, 4 and 5, and be an ambitious person with high expectations for yourself and your students.

We offer a very extensive extra-curricular sports program and manage a number of teams in numerous activities, competing at borough, regional and national level. The successful applicant would be expected to make a significant contribution to these.

A full and clean driving license would be advantageous.

The successful candidate will:
  • Be able to develop, plan and deliver effective and high-quality learning experiences to all students
  • Be a newly qualified or experienced teacher who is enthusiastic, influential and committed to working in pursuit of success for the academy and its learners.

Orleans Park is a happy, thriving, successful and oversubscribed 11-18 mixed comprehensive that serves its local community in Twickenham with over 1,350 students.

Here’s what Ofsted have to say:



In November 2017, Ofsted recognised that Orleans Park is an outstanding school.  They said “Orleans Park excels in all the aspects of provision for its pupils” and we have “established an inspirational teaching and learning environment where pupils can flourish and excel”.
